Hi,
I have a late 2012 27" iMac 3.4GHz Quad core i7 with plenty of RAM and I am getting very long render times in lightroom (30 minutes). It seems that my CPU is anywhere from 40-70% idle during the process. Also my graphics card GTX 680MX seems completely idle during the process. Is LTR render in Lightroom just not able to use all of my system resources? Or am i doing something wrong?
   

I've also included a screenshot of my CPU activity during my export to video in LTR compared with the render in lightroom (left on the graph)
   
Offline
#2 Gunther
It's Lightroom not using multi-processing ressurces when exporting - unfortunately. You might export different sequences at one time, this will raise processor load.
